Don't Have Lens Enabled?

Contact Your Admin to Turn-On Rescue Lens TIP: Users need to be running the Rescue v7.6 technician console which you can find here: Desktop Technician Console or Browser Technician Console

Administrators are required

to enable Rescue Lens

1. Log in to the LogMeIn Rescue Administration Center

2. On the organization tree, select the Technician Group you want to work with

3. Select the Organization tab

4. Under Permissions, select Rescue Lens

5. Click Save Changes
